About The Position

North State Bank has an exciting opportunity for a Lead Teller serving the Wake Forest Office. The Lead Teller represents the bank to the customer in a courteous, professional manner, by providing prompt, efficient, and accurate service in processing financial transactions.

Requirements

  • A high school diploma or equivalent.
  • One year of previous teller experience.
  • Excellent customer service skills.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• A strong analytical ability.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Excel, Word, and Outlook, and the Internet, or equivalent software.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for maintaining and balancing a teller cash drawer.
  • Identifies and reports on possible fraudulent or suspicious activity.
  • Ensures the office cash is reconciled to the general ledger daily. Researches and corrects account posting errors.
  • Performs vault teller duties, including maintaining reserve supply, buying and selling cash to and from tellers, ATM, and ATM balancing and replenishment.
  • Enters customer transactions, including deposits, loan payments, account transfers, into the teller system to record transactions and issues a validated receipt upon request in accordance with bank policy.
  • Ensures all teller reports and logs are completed with all the required information. Assist in the completion of office monthly and quarterly self-audits.
  • Receives checks and cash for deposit, verifies amount, examines for endorsement and negotiability.
  • Cashes checks, savings withdrawals and redeem bonds upon verification of negotiability, identification, account alert messages, signatures and account balances according to bank policy, within limits, and obtaining further authorization as required.
  • Place holds on accounts in accordance with bank policy and compliance regulations.
  • Processes deposits from night depository, mail, and courier bag transactions in accordance with bank policy and procedures.
  • Provides general guidance and approvals to tellers, cross-training, and provides performance feedback to the Relationship Banking Manager.
  • Issues official checks, instant issue debit cards and sells gift cards in accordance with bank policy and procedures.
  • Assist with customer inquiries via phone, email, and in person to include, but not limited to: Online banking password resets, ordering customer checks upon request, accepting and preparing stop payment requests.
  • Collects and enters information required to complete a Currency Transaction Report and Monetary Instrument Log when necessary.
  • Identifies referral opportunities and makes appropriate referrals.
  • Scans teller work for overnight posting to customer accounts.
  • Admits customers into safe deposit box in accordance with bank policy and procedures.
  • Assists management to ensure Office Security Binder and Red Binders are complete with updated forms and information.
  • Basic knowledge of bank products and services to answer customer inquiries.
  • May assist management with daily report monitoring of DDA, Savings and DepositScan limit exceptions.
  • Prepares documentation for wire transfer request within assigned limits.
  • Attends or participates in regular meetings or training sessions to continue growth in products, relationship building, service, policy, procedures, and compliance regulations.
  • Provides back up for Relationship Banking Specialist duties when required
